The EMN produces a variety of publications that are based on inputs from the National Contact Points (NCPs) and are available to the wider public. The topics are selected jointly by the NCPs and the European Commission on an annual basis. These publications provide up-to-date, objective, reliable, comparable and policy-relevant information on migration and asylum issues across Europe.
